Fingerprint recognition

Fingerprint recognition overview

You must register your fingerprint on your device first before using the fingerprint recognition function.

You can use the fingerprint recognition function in the following cases:

To unlock the screen.

To view locked contents in Gallery or QuickMemo+.

Confirm a purchase by signing in to an app or identifying yourself with your fingerprint.

Your fingerprint can be used by the device for user identification. Very similar fingerprints from different users may be recognized by the fingerprint sensor as the same fingerprint. To ensure security, set the screen lock using a pattern, PIN or Password.

Precautions for fingerprint recognition

Fingerprint recognition accuracy may decrease due to a number of reasons. To maximize the recognition accuracy, check the following before using the device.

Ensure that the fingerprint sensor is not damaged by a metallic object, such as coin or key.

When water, dust or other foreign substance is on the fingerprint sensor or your finger, the fingerprint registration or recognition may not work. Clean and dry your finger before using the fingerprint sensor.

A fingerprint may not be recognized properly if the surface of your finger has a scar or is not smooth due to being soaked in water.

If you bend your finger or use the fingertip only, your fingerprint may not be recognized. Make sure that your finger covers the entire surface of the fingerprint sensor.

Custom-designed Features

12

Scan only one finger for each registration. Scanning more than one finger may affect fingerprint registration and recognition.

The device may generate static electricity if the surrounding air is dry. If the surrounding air is dry, avoid scanning fingerprints, or touch a metallic object, such as coin or key, to remove static electricity before scanning fingerprints.

Face Recognition

Face recognition overview

You can unlock the screen by using face recognition.

This feature may be more vulnerable to security than the other screen locks, such as a Pattern, PIN, and Password.

When a similar face or a photo of your face is used, the screen may be unlocked.

The recognized facial data is securely stored in your device.

If the device cannot detect your face, or you forgot the screen lock set for your device, visit the nearest LG Customer Service Center with your device and ID card.

To save power, the face recognition feature will not work when the battery level is below 5%.

Precautions for face recognition

Face recognition accuracy may decrease in the following cases. To increase its accuracy, check the following before using the device.

When your face is covered with a hat, eyeglasses, or mask, or your face is significantly different due to heavy makeup or beard.

When there are fingerprints or foreign substances on the front of the camera lens, or your device cannot detect your face due to excessively bright or dark conditions.

Proximity/Ambient light sensor

-- Proximity sensor: During a call, the proximity sensor turns off the screen and disables touch functionality when the device is in close proximity to the human body. It turns the screen back on and enables touch functionality when the device is outside a specific range.

-- Ambient light sensor: The ambient light sensor analyzes the ambient light intensity when the auto-brightness control mode is turned on.

Volume keys

-- Adjust the volume for ringtones, calls or notifications.

-- While using the Camera, gently press a Volume key to take a photo. To take continuous photos, press and hold the Volume key.

-- Press the Volume Down key twice to launch the Camera app when the screen is locked or turned off. Press the Volume Up key twice to launch Capture+.

Power/Lock key

-- Briefly press the key when you want to turn the screen on or off.

-- Press and hold the key when you want to select a power control option.
